Khái niệm CSDL phân tán

Một phần của tài liệu GIÁO ÁN TIN HỌC LỚP 12 (Trang 108 - 110)

- Nên chọn khóa chính là khóa có ít thuộc tính nhất.

a.Khái niệm CSDL phân tán

- CSDL phân tán là một tập hợp dữ liệu có liên quan (về logic) được dùng chung và phân tán về mặt vật lí trên một mạng máy tính.

Một hệ QTCSDL phân tán là một hệ

thống phần mềm cho phép quản trị CSDL phân tán và làm cho người sử dụng không nhận thấy sự phân tán về lưu trữ dữ liệu.

- Người dùng truy cập vào CSDL phân tán thông quan chương trình ứng dụng. Các chương trình ứng dụng được chia làm hai loại:

GV: Cần phải phân biệt CSDL phân tán với xử lí phân tán. Điểm quan trọng trong khái niệm CSDL phân tán là ở chỗ các dữ liệu được chia ra đặt ở những trạm khác nhau trên mạng. Nếu dữ liệu tập trung tại một trạm và những người dùng trên các trạm khác có thể truy cập được dữ liệu này, ta nói đó là hệ CSDL tập trung xử lí phân tán chứ không phải là CSDL phân tán.

Hình 52. Hệ CSDL phân tán

Hình 53. Hệ CSDL tập trung xử lí phân tán

GV: Ở CSDL tập trung, khi một trạm làm việc gặp sự cố thì công việc ở trạm đó và các trạm khác sẽ bị ngừng lại. Trong khi đó các hệ CSDL phân tán được thết kế để hệ thống tiếp tục làm việc được cho dù gặp sự cố ở một số trạm. Nếu một nút (trên mạng) bị hỏng thì hệ thống có thể chuyển những

nơi khác.

+ Chương trình có yêu cầu dữ liệu từ nơi khác. - Có thể chia các hệ CSDL phân tán thành 2 loại chính: thuần nhất và hỗn hợp. + Hệ CSDL phân tán thuần nhất: các nút trên mạng đều dùng cùng một hệ QTCSDL. + Hệ CSDL phân tán hỗn hợp: các nút trên mạng có thể dùng các hệ QTCSDL khác nhau.

yêu cầu dữ liệu của nút này đến cho một nút khác.

GV: Kết hợp với phần trước nêu ví dụ thực tế cho HS thấy được ưu điểm và nhược điểm của hệ

Một phần của tài liệu GIÁO ÁN TIN HỌC LỚP 12 (Trang 108 - 110)